These inboard ski boats are known to ride a bit rougher than v hull. If you are a water skier then this is what you are looking for. Flat wakes and plenty of torque to pull. This can't be met by boats with outdrives. These boats are well built and relatively easy to maintain. It depends on what you like, as well as where you are giong to use it. Great for smaller lakes and rivers. If you prefer to cruise, I suggest a v bottom with sterndrive.

Top of the line ski/wakeboard boat, that one has some average, maybe high hours on it. MUCH better build quality than your average Bayliner. Many were equipped with a ballast system to pump fresh water on board to trim the wake. They are ski boats by design, and very good ones. But with any used boat purchase, invest in a good professional looking over before stepping up. They love flat water and aren't great general purpose craft. I've got a couple of friends that have them and they seem to hold up well.

If you want to use it for wake boarding you better make sure it has the kind of wake you want. That boat may be a straight ski boat from that vintage, which will have too flat of a wake for boarding without ballast.
